X-Git-Url: https://gerrit.o-ran-sc.org/r/gitweb?a=blobdiff_plain;ds=sidebyside;f=webapp-backend%2Fsrc%2Fmain%2Fjava%2Forg%2Foranosc%2Fric%2Fportal%2Fdash%2FXappManagerConfiguration.java;fp=webapp-backend%2Fsrc%2Fmain%2Fjava%2Forg%2Foranosc%2Fric%2Fportal%2Fdash%2FXappManagerConfiguration.java;h=bdee12cc68014a170a75ab3da5271b90e9ae2984;hb=056a49df629daf4189a34c37ee30b1f5ad88a59d;hp=b0f04a77af47c701d3fa16511e301707bf50abbb;hpb=e2cbc4d0304646febf7e2cbe0dccdf9840189222;p=portal%2Fric-dashboard.git diff --git a/webapp-backend/src/main/java/org/oranosc/ric/portal/dash/XappManagerConfiguration.java b/webapp-backend/src/main/java/org/oranosc/ric/portal/dash/XappManagerConfiguration.java index b0f04a77..bdee12cc 100644 --- a/webapp-backend/src/main/java/org/oranosc/ric/portal/dash/XappManagerConfiguration.java +++ b/webapp-backend/src/main/java/org/oranosc/ric/portal/dash/XappManagerConfiguration.java @@ -19,16 +19,14 @@ */ package org.oranosc.ric.portal.dash; -import org.oranosc.ric.portal.dashboard.xmc.api.DefaultApi; -import org.oranosc.ric.portal.dashboard.xmc.invoker.ApiClient; +import org.oranosc.ric.xappmgr.client.api.DefaultApi; +import org.oranosc.ric.xappmgr.client.invoker.ApiClient; import org.springframework.beans.factory.annotation.Value; import org.springframework.context.annotation.Bean; -import org.springframework.context.annotation.ComponentScan; import org.springframework.context.annotation.Configuration; import org.springframework.web.client.RestTemplate; @Configuration -@ComponentScan("org.oranosc.ric.portal") public class XappManagerConfiguration { @Value("${xapp.manager.base.url}") @@ -40,20 +38,10 @@ public class XappManagerConfiguration { * @return Instance of ApiClient configured from properties */ @Bean - public ApiClient apiClient() { - ApiClient apiClient = new ApiClient(); + public ApiClient xappApiClient() { + ApiClient apiClient = new ApiClient(new RestTemplate()); apiClient.setBasePath(xappManagerBaseUrl); return apiClient; } - /** - * Required by autowired constructor {@link ApiClient#ApiClient(RestTemplate)} - * - * @return Instance of RestTemplate - */ - @Bean - public RestTemplate restTemplate() { - return new RestTemplate(); - } - }